This is a superb antique large Gustav Stickley dining table from the early 1900s Mission and Arts & Crafts period in very good condition.

The piece has a great 5 legged design with 4 original leaves in their original leaf holder.

The table is made of excellent, thick quarter sawn oak with a great original finish with excellent color.

The table sits on original casters and is sturdy, strong, thick, and bulky.

This is a very desirable design. It is signed with a paper label as pictured.

3 of the leaves are obviously a different color as you see in the pictures. We do not know why this is.

All the leaves are marked “23” and then marked 1 through 4 as you can see.

They are the original leaves but seem to have aged differently than the table.

Dimensions in Inches:
H – 30
Diameter (Closed) – 48
Leaves – 12
Total Open – 96
